Beverage Closures Market Trends & Size 2026-2035

Beverage Closures Market Size and Segments Outlook (2026–2035)

The global beverage closures market, valued at USD 7.62 billion in 2025, is anticipated to reach USD 11.66 billion by 2035, growing at a CAGR of 4.35% over the next decade. The report also evaluates leading manufacturers and suppliers, assessing their production capacities, geographic presence, and strategic developments, such as Origin Materials’ and Berry Global’s innovations in PET and fibre-based closures. Furthermore, the value chain analysis highlights key cost structures, logistics frameworks, and the evolving trade flows shaping the industry.
